Pulsed-Field Ablation for Paroxysmal Atrial Fibrillation in a Pediatric Patient
Fuqiang Liu1, Yimin Hua1, Yifei Li2,3
1Key Laboratory of Birth Defects and Related Diseases of Women and Children of MOE, West China Second University Hospital, Sichuan University, Chengdu, 610041, Sichuan, China.
This study details a successful cardiac pulsed-field ablation (PFA) for a 12-year-old with paroxysmal atrial fibrillation (AF). PFA shows promise as a superior treatment for young patients with AF.
Area of Science:
- Cardiology
- Electrophysiology
- Medical Technology
Background:
- Paroxysmal atrial fibrillation (AF) can be symptomatic and debilitating.
- Catheter ablation is a common treatment for AF.
- Novel ablation technologies are needed, especially for pediatric patients.
Purpose of the Study:
- To report the first documented case of successful catheter ablation for paroxysmal AF in a pediatric patient using cardiac pulsed-field ablation (PFA) technology.
- To evaluate the feasibility and efficacy of PFA in a young patient population.
Main Methods:
- A 12-year-old male with symptomatic paroxysmal AF underwent catheter ablation.
- Cardiac pulsed-field ablation (PFA) technology (LEAD-PFA, JJET) was employed.
- A systematic lesion creation protocol targeted pulmonary veins and surrounding regions.
Main Results:
- Atrial fibrillation (AF) was induced during the procedure but terminated post-ablation.
- Successful pulmonary vein isolation was achieved using PFA.
- The procedure was technically successful without immediate complications.
Conclusions:
- Catheter ablation using PFA technology is a viable option for treating paroxysmal AF in pediatric patients.
- PFA may offer advantages over traditional ablation methods in young individuals.
- Further research is warranted to establish PFA as a standard therapy for pediatric AF.
